2. Obstacles Of Reusing Solar Panels
It is extensively approved that reusing solar panels has several ecological benefits, however, it is additionally real that the process isn't without its difficulties. But just what are these obstacles? Allow's check out further.
One of the largest problems with reusing photovoltaic panels is the complexity of the task itself. It can be challenging to break down the various components, such as glass and metal, to be recycled separately. Furthermore, photovoltaic panel makers frequently have a mix of materials used in their items which makes arranging them much more complicated. In addition, there are safety and security and health threats involved with taking care of busted glass or inhaling fumes from melting components.
Another essential challenge connected with recycling photovoltaic panels is cost. Many nations do not have sufficient facilities or sources to effectively recycle these things which brings about higher costs for businesses trying to do so. Additionally, due to the customized nature of recycling photovoltaic panels, this can create a monetary problem on firms attempting to remain certified with laws. Ultimately, these expenses could be passed down to consumers making it hard for them to pay for renewable resource sources.

3. Approaches For Reusing Solar Panels
As the world pursues a much more lasting future, recycling solar panels is a significantly prominent job. Among this expanding passion, nonetheless, we have to think about the techniques that are in place to make it feasible.
To begin with, several business have actually carried out a 'take-back' system where old or damaged solar panels can be gathered and sent out to their corresponding manufacturing facilities for reusing. In this manner, the materials have the ability to be recycled in the construction of brand-new items. In addition, some districts have actually also started using motivations for individuals desiring to reuse their solar panels; this might vary from tax breaks to complimentary shipping prices.
In addition, modern technology has actually come to be increasingly innovative when it concerns reusing photovoltaic panels-- with specialist equipments with the ability of separating out all the different components within them. For instance, by utilizing AI-powered robotic arms, these makers can draw out valuable products such as copper and aluminium while likewise disposing of hazardous waste securely.
